It's Official! We're a "Good School"
Tuesday, 17 March 2009 00:00
Calder House has received a FANTASTIC write up in the Good Schools Guide following last month’s visit by a GSG inspector. The review, which can be viewed in full on the Guide’s website, praises Calder House’s “amazing success rate” in returning pupils to mainstream education and describes “a happy school where children can regain their self esteem”.
 
“I’m absolutely delighted with the inspector’s comments” beamed headmaster Andrew Day. “Calder House has been listed in the Good School’s Guide for many years but only the best schools are singled out for inspector’s reviews – and not many schools get reviews this good!”

Mr Day would also like to thank on behalf of the school the many parents of pupils and former pupils who recommended Calder House to the Good Schools Guide. “We want you all to know how much the school appreciates your support!”
